Okpebholo Inaugurates Committee Against Drug Abuse

Senator Monday Okpeholo, the governor of Edo State, has officially launched a comprehensive drug control committee at both the state and local government levels to strengthen efforts against drug abuse throughout the region.

Governor Okpeholo highlighted this move as a crucial measure in the state’s dedication to eradicating drug trafficking and curbing substance misuse, particularly among young people.

Speaking through his deputy, Rt. Hon. Dennis Idahosa, the governor expressed deep concern over the escalating problem of drug addiction and its detrimental effects on the community.

According to a statement from Mr. Friday Aghedo, Chief Press Secretary to the deputy governor, Governor Okpeholo emphasized that the formation of this committee is in line with the national drug masterplan, marking a proactive approach to safeguarding future generations.

Brigadier-General Buba Marwa, Chairman of the National Drug Law Enforcement Agency (NDLEA), represented by Zonal Commander ACGN Fidelis Cocodia of Zone 13, stressed the importance of grassroots engagement, public education campaigns, and robust support networks as essential pillars in combating drug abuse.

Mr. Mitchell Ofoyeju, Edo State’s NDLEA Commander, revealed that while the national average for drug use prevalence is 14.4 percent, Edo State’s rate is notably higher at 15 percent.

He warned that Edo is among the states most severely affected by drug-related issues, which have contributed to increased criminal activity and greater susceptibility among the youth.

Dr. Cyril Oshiomhole, the state’s Health Commissioner, committed to positioning Edo as a leading example in drug control by focusing on rehabilitation programs, educational outreach for young people, and providing renewed opportunities for those recovering from addiction.

Mrs. Edesili Okpeholo Anani, Coordinator of the Office of the Edo State First Lady, described drug abuse as a widespread crisis, observing that drug involvement is linked to nearly all criminal acts.

She further emphasized the critical role of women’s compassion and leadership in driving the campaign to eliminate drug abuse from the community.
